List of top 8 sights

DOM St. Anastasius and St. Innocentius: an impressive Gothic building that impresses with its artistic glass windows and the detailed altar.

Roswitha monument: A monument in honor of the first German poet Roswitha von Gandersheim.

Kurpark Bad Gandersheim: An idyllic place that offers calm and relaxation, with colorful flower beds and rippling wells.

Heimatmuseum: A museum that brings the history of the city and the region to life.

Brunshausen monastery: An impressive monastery that reflects the monastic history of the region.

Historical old town: The old town of Bad Gandersheim with its half -timbered houses and narrow streets is a step back into the past.
